About Ran Tao

Ran Tao is a scholar working on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ering, Pollution and Molecular Medicine, having authored 35 papers that have together received 1.6k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Constructed Wetlands for Wastewater Treatment (21 papers), Pharmaceutical and Antibiotic Environmental Impacts (20 papers) and Wastewater Treatment and Reuse (9 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Pollution (982 citations),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ering (600 citations) and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is (315 citations). Ran Tao has collaborated with scholars based in China, Hong Kong and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Yang Yang, Yunv Dai, Yiping Tai, Xiaoyan Tang, Xiaomeng Zhang, N.F.Y. Tam, Dan A, Haochang Su, Ying Man and Guang‐Guo Ying. Their work appears in journals such as Environmental Science & Technology, The Science of The Total Environment and Journal of Hazardous Materials.
